Jesus Christ is believed by Christians to have been born in Bethlehem around 4 BCE. He is considered the Son of God and the Messiah promised in the Old Testament. Jesus performed miracles, preached about love, forgiveness, and mercy, and gathered disciples to spread his teachings. His crucifixion, burial, and resurrection are central events in Christian belief, signifying his sacrifice for the salvation of humanity. Jesus' life and teachings have had a profound and lasting impact on the development of Western civilization, influencing art, literature, ethics, and social values.

3 reasons why hes influential

1) Moral teachings: Jesus Christ's teachings emphasized love, forgiveness, and compassion. His message of loving one's neighbor, turning the other cheek, and treating others as you would like to be treated has had a profound influence on ethical and moral principles in Western society. His teachings provide a moral compass for many individuals, shaping their values and guiding their actions.

2) Spiritual significance: Jesus Christ is considered the central figure of Christianity, the world's largest religion. His resurrection is believed to offer eternal life to believers, and his divinity holds spiritual significance for millions of people. The concept of Christ's redeeming sacrifice offers comfort, hope, and a sense of purpose to followers, influencing their faith and impacting their spiritual lives.

3) Cultural and historical impact: The life and teachings of Jesus Christ have had a significant impact on art, literature, music, and other forms of cultural expression. Depictions of Jesus in art, such as Leonardo da Vinci's "The Last Supper" or Michelangelo's "The Pieta," have become iconic symbols of religious devotion and artistic achievement. Moreover, Jesus' teachings have inspired countless works of literature and provided a foundation for ethical and moral discussions throughout history, making him a central figure in shaping the course of Western civilization.
